Pros

ABB is a global company that promotes cross training and likes to promote from within. There are plenty of opportunities and the salary is competitive. Employees are vary valued and management cares about if you are happy or not.

Cons

Process improvement needed at least where I work. Management wants the team to drive improvement and change but I feel a lack of follow through to continue. HR and IT are overseas

Fresh new leadership but existing culture needs to change

Anonymous employee
Recommend
Business Outlook

Pros

Large international company with terrific career opportunities for upwardly mobile individuals and leaders This building has several US Utility Industry-recognized subject matter experts in high voltage transmission equipment New leadership has fresh ideas of how to turn around ABB's high voltage business challenges with quality and customer focus

Cons

The new leadership is refreshing but the rank-and-file white collar work force still has a predominantly "not my job, not my problem" attitude. There is a deeply embedded culture of willful helplessness, and a tolerance for mediocrity There is an alarming lack of digitalization of internal work processes, and a lack of automation for even the most basic workflow tasks. Productivity and quality suffers due to multiple manual processes and disconnected systems. This is very disappointing, considering ABB's market reputation for leading-edge technology.

Diminishing Opportunities?

Anonymous employee
Recommend
Business Outlook

Pros

I've been with ABB for almost 15 years. In general the company has been good to work for with fair compensation and benefits. As a global company there have been opportunities to collaborate with colleagues around the world. ABB has also taken a more strategic view of business. Not to discount the importance of monthly, quarterly and annual business objectives but ABB has tended toward a longer strategic horizon than some other companies I am familiar with. ABB has a culture of integrity, safety, quality and innovation -- all of which contribute to a positive place to work.

Cons

Over my time with ABB it seems that the United States, while nominally an important market is seeing increasing off-shoring of both manufacturing and managerial positions. Today, ABB announced that consideration of annual merit increases will be deferred until later -- perhaps at the end of Q2 (normally this is a March activity), but no firm statement that this is only a 3-4 month delay. At a time US unemployment is at a record low numbers and many companies -- particularly global entities -- are moving to repatriate jobs and give both bonuses and significant pay raises, ABB decides to NOT take care of its loyal employees. Instead they spend $2.6 billion to buy a failing division (GE Industrial) from a competitor that knew it's days were numbered.
